
Aston Villa respond to Premier League club interest in Ezri Konsa
Aston Villa will not sell Ezri Konsa under any circumstances in the January transfer window, sources have told Football Insider.
That is despite the fact that reports have linked Konsa to multiple Premier League clubs in recent weeks.
Manchester City and Tottenham are among those apparently interested in the England international, following his impressive start to the season.
However, sources say that Villa are desperate to keep hold of Konsa, as he is one of their most important players.

Ezri Konsa committed to Aston Villa amid contract update
Konsa still has just under three years remaining on his current Aston Villa contract, and if he saw the entirety of the deal through, he would remain in the Midlands until the summer of 2028.
Sources say that the defender is very settled at Villa Park and is fully focused on ensuring his side’s good run of form continues.
Unai Emery came under a bit of pressure during Villa’s difficult start to the season, but the Spaniard has now guided his side to four straight Premier League wins.
The Midlands giants are up to eighth in the table, and are just two points adrift of Sunderland in the final Champions League spot.
Aston Villa to secure future of star player
Meanwhile, Aston Villa are set to secure the future of another one of their star players, with Morgan Rogers in advanced talks to agree a new deal.

Football Insider exclusively revealed in September that Aston Villa had opened talks with Rogers over a contract extension.
Emery then recently confirmed that negotiations regarding the highly rated midfielder were underway.
Sources say that both parties are now close to an agreement, which would see Villa tie Rogers down for an extended period.
